An organic-inorganic hybrid compound constructed by polytungsto-vanadosilicate and hexadecyltrimethyl ammonium as an efficient catalyst for demercaptanization of crude oil

[C16H33N(CH3)(3)](4)H3SiV3W9O40 has been synthesized by reaction of Naio[alpha-SiW9O34] with sodium vanadate and encapsulated by cetyltrimethyl ammonium. Then this organic-inorganic hybrid compound condensation with titanium tetraisopropoxide at 100 degrees C via sol-gel method under oil-bath condition. [C16H33N(CH3)(3)](4)H3SiV3W9O40-TiO2 was prepared. The materials characterized by IR, XRD, TEM and UV-vis techniques. This alkyl ammonium keggin-type nanoparticle be able to scavenge mercaptans and hydrogen sulfide (with high yield) in the presence of H2O2. This system provides a practical, convenient and efficient method for scavenging of sulfur compound in light and heavy crude oil. (C) 2014 The Korean Society of Industrial and Engineering Chemistry.
